I'm wondering if anyone can give me a rough estimate of how big/heavy the 15" wide T61p is vs. the 15" T42p.
I find the 14" non wide T4x and T6x to be nice and small, easy to carry. My 15" T42p is a bit heavier and basically at the limit of what I'd want to carry every day.
Posted: Sun Aug 12, 2007 12:08 pm
by csv96
Imagine a 14.1" (non-wide) T4x/T6x. Add about 1" width, 1/4" thickness, and 1/2 lb weight and you have a 15.4" T6x.

Well if the 15" T42p was at your limit for carrying around, then I defintely don't suggest a 15" T61p widescreen. The extra size and weight (especially with the 9 cell battery) makes the T6xp WS a bit cumbersome-not terrible mind you, but no where near the light weight of the standard T4x series.
I just ordered a 14.1" SXGA+ T61p the other day to take the place of my current 15.4" T60p. I just don't like the extra size and weight.
